Se les llama mantis o "gamba mantis" por presentar cierto parecido con tales insectos, en particular unas … immaculate facility servicesWeb25. nov 2015. · Mantis shrimps are crustaceans, like crabs, rock lobsters and other shrimps. They are the only animals to have hyperspectral colour vision and are considered to have the most complex eyes in the animal kingdom. They can see ultraviolet, visible and infra-red light and different planes of polarized light. Notably, intelligence as most crustaceans has terrible intelligence. … immaculate dwarven gauntletsWebIt is a large mantis shrimp, ranging in size from 3 to 18 cm (1.2 to 7.1 in). They are primarily green with orange legs and leopard-like spots on the anterior carapace. This mantis shrimp is a smasher, with club-shaped raptorial appendages. The peacock mantis shrimp is kept by some saltwater aquarists. list of schools in watford
